Quiet Existence Poem by Mahmoodul Haque Sayed

Quiet Existence



Oh unseen sweetheart of mine you live too high
everywhere I searched:
amid the chirpiness of native birds
amid the sweet songs of bulbuls
amid the sweet verses of lyrical poems
amid the buzzing of bees in the garden
amid the melody of pastoral song of herdsmen
amid the melody of boatsong of boatmen
amid the murmur of the distant brook
nowhere could I find you-
silently you play a flute there
in my mind & heart at all hours - silently
